From 9bbf8fb63027a2aa85d45e4f0e737e472d551eee Mon Sep 17 00:00:00 2001 From: Gabriel Odero Date: Sat, 5 Aug 2023 16:19:26 +0300 Subject: [PATCH] Transaction id validation removed --- MpesaSdk/Validators/MpesaTransactionStatusValidator.cs | 6 ------ 1 file changed, 6 deletions(-) diff --git a/MpesaSdk/Validators/MpesaTransactionStatusValidator.cs b/MpesaSdk/Validators/MpesaTransactionStatusValidator.cs index e05ffeb..4c9b8d8 100644 --- a/MpesaSdk/Validators/MpesaTransactionStatusValidator.cs +++ b/MpesaSdk/Validators/MpesaTransactionStatusValidator.cs @@ -51,12 +51,6 @@ public MpesaTransactionStatusValidator() .WithMessage("{PropertyName} - The result url is required.") .Must(x => LinkMustBeAUri(x)) .WithMessage("{PropertyName} - The result url should be a valid secure url."); - - RuleFor(x => x.TransactionID) - .NotNull() - .WithMessage("{PropertyName} - The Mpesa transactionID is required.") - .NotEmpty() - .WithMessage("{PropertyName} - The Mpesa transactionID should not be empty."); } private static bool LinkMustBeAUri(string link)